Klarner, D.A. and K. Post, Some fascinating integer sequences, Discrete Mathematics 106/107 (1992) 303-309. A class of recursively defined sets of integers is investigated. Their asymptotic densities and recognizability by a suitable finite automaton are illustrated by an example.
